L.M. Cameron: Warrington v. St. Helens

Stood in the Fletcher End when all we needed was the kick to beat St Helens. They had nobbled Iestyn Harris but I don't know who kicked but we missed it - please someone enlighten me!

L M Cameron

Comment from Brendan Douglas, June 12th 2013: It was Chris Rudd.

In 1996 St. Helens won 25-24 at Warrington, after Lee Penny had been sent off and Chris Rudd missed a penalty from halfway in injury time. Could this be the mystery match?
